
Microneedling
Consider it as a revolutionary skin regeneration treatment combining concentrated radio frequency radiation with precise micro-needles. Unlike traditional approaches, Profound RF microneedling delivers thermal energy directly into the dermis, triggering intensive collagen induction and immediate skin tightening.
The treatment creates thousands of microscopic channels while emitting controlled RF pulses deep within your skin. This dual-action approach fundamentally remodels your skin’s architecture from within, with dramatic microneedling before and after results particularly noticeable in stubborn concerns like deep acne scars and pronounced wrinkles that resist conventional treatments.
Who Gets Microneedling?
From rising executives to active parents, Profound RF microneedling transforms skin concerns across generations. The sweet spot? Adults between their late twenties and sixties who’ve caught those first whispers of aging. Beyond the buzz of “Is microneedling worth it?” the results speak volumes – especially for those seeking refined skin texture without the lengthy downtime of invasive procedures.
Not everyone’s skin story aligns with this treatment path, though. Active acne, pregnancy, recent Accutane use, or autoimmune conditions signal a pause in your journey. The presence of metal implants near target areas or a history of keloid scarring also reshapes your options. Yet for those watching subtle shifts in their skin’s narrative – whether it’s fading firmness or lingering acne scars – this treatment offers a measured approach to renewal, favouring progressive enhancement over dramatic intervention.
Microneedling is less invasive than plastic surgery and involves minimal recovery time. Most people experience little to no downtime after the procedure.
Some skin irritation and redness may occur within the first few days, a natural response to the tiny “injuries” created by the needles.
You can return to work or school shortly after the treatment if you’re comfortable. However, allowing your skin to heal before applying makeup is best.
Your skin will be more sensitive to the sun, so it’s important to use sunscreen. We typically recommend waiting about a week before exposing your skin to direct sunlight or harsh chemicals.
After microneedling, your skin rejuvenates fairly quickly, and you may notice results within a couple of weeks.
